To block specific device(s)
1 ) Select
Block wireless access from the devices in the list
below
and click Save.
2 ) Select the device(s) to be blocked in the
Devices Online
table.
3 ) Click
Block above the Devices Online table. The selected
devices will be added to
Devices List automatically.
To allow specific device(s)
1 ) Select
Allow wireless access only from the devices in the
list below
and click Save.
2 ) Click
Add.
3 ) Enter the MAC Address (You can copy and paste the MAC
Address
from Devices Online list if the device is connected
to your wireless network) and enter the
Description of
the device.
4 ) Select the checkbox to enable this entry, and click
OK.
Now MAC Filtering is implemented to protect your wireless
network.
6. 2. Access Control
Access Control is used to block or allow specific client devices to access your network
(via wired or wireless) based on a list of blocked devices (Blacklist) or a list of allowed
devices (Whitelist).
